GigaDeal -> Longhorn

How is upgrading going to work? I've paid for a year of Gigadeal.

You can take your pick. You either stay at Gigadeal for as long as you like - you'll simply be billed again for that at the end of your year. Or you can upgrade to any package current at time of upgrade - Longhorn right now - in which case the part of your payment you have not yet enjoyed services for is credited to that new package.
